What’s Actually in an Electrolyte Drink?
Most electrolyte drinks combine water, electrolytes (primarily sodium and potassium, sometimes magnesium and calcium), and often some form of carbohydrate (usually sugar) to support both hydration and energy replenishment during exercise. Formulations vary considerably in their specific electrolyte content and carbohydrate concentration.
Do You Actually Need One?
For most everyday situations — light-to-moderate exercise under an hour, normal daily activities, mild heat exposure — plain water combined with a normal, varied diet provides adequate hydration and electrolyte replacement without needing a specialized drink.
Electrolyte drinks become more genuinely useful in specific situations:
- Exercise lasting longer than 60-90 minutes, particularly in hot or humid conditions
- Heavy sweating or being a known “salty sweater”
- Illness involving vomiting or diarrhea, where fluid and electrolyte losses can be substantial
- Hot weather exposure combined with physical exertion, such as outdoor labor or sports
Types of Electrolyte Products
Traditional sports drinks (like classic formulations found in most grocery stores) typically contain moderate electrolyte content along with meaningful sugar content, designed to support both hydration and energy during longer exercise sessions.
Low-sugar or sugar-free electrolyte products have become increasingly popular, offering electrolyte replacement without the added sugar, which may appeal to those exercising for shorter durations or managing overall sugar intake.
Oral rehydration solutions are specifically formulated (often with a particular ratio of electrolytes and glucose) to optimize fluid absorption, commonly used for rehydration during illness involving vomiting or diarrhea, particularly in children.
Electrolyte tablets and powders offer a concentrated, portable way to add electrolytes to plain water, popular among endurance athletes and hikers for their convenience.
What to Look for in a Quality Electrolyte Product
Adequate sodium content. Sodium is generally the most important electrolyte to replace during heavy sweating, so look for products with a meaningful sodium content (typically at least 200mg per serving for exercise-focused products) rather than minimal “trace” amounts.
Appropriate for your specific use case. A product with significant added sugar makes sense during prolonged, intense exercise where the carbohydrate content also supports energy needs, but may be unnecessary — even counterproductive from a calorie standpoint — for shorter exercise sessions or everyday use.
Reasonable ingredient list. Watch for excessive added sugars, artificial ingredients, or proprietary blends that obscure actual electrolyte content, particularly in less established or heavily marketed products.
Homemade Alternatives
A simple, cost-effective homemade electrolyte drink can be made by combining water with a small amount of salt, a squeeze of citrus for potassium and flavor, and a modest amount of natural sweetener if desired — providing similar core benefits to commercial products without the cost or, in some cases, excessive sugar content of certain branded options.
When to Avoid Overdoing Electrolyte Drinks
For people not engaged in intense or prolonged exercise, regularly consuming electrolyte drinks — particularly higher-sugar varieties — as a routine daily beverage rather than reserving them for genuine higher-need situations can contribute unnecessary added sugar and calories to the diet without providing meaningful additional benefit over plain water and a normal diet.
The Bottom Line
Electrolyte drinks serve a genuine, useful purpose during prolonged or intense exercise, hot weather exposure, or illness involving significant fluid loss — but they’re not a necessary daily beverage for most people engaged in typical, moderate activity. Matching the product (and its sugar content) to your actual level of need is the most sensible approach.
